1.5.4.1 RMS Protection
The RMS protection acts to limit the current provided to the rated continuous current of the drive. Thus, a G361-x006
cannot supply, on average, greater than 6A
continuous
RMS to the motor. The current to the motor is averaged and if it
exceeds the RMS rating, the drive limits the current command. If the controller continuously demands current greater
than the drive capability, the RMS protection will limit the actual current supplied to the drive rating. The time for which
peak current can be supplied is dependent on whether the motor is stalled or running.
1.5.4.2 Thermal Foldback
Thermal foldback is implemented in the DS2100 drives to prevent the junction temperatures of the amplifier bridge
IGBT’s exceeding their maximum rated temperature. The thermal foldback is based on a measure of the heatsink
temperature and the mode in which the drive is operating (motor running or stalled). As the heatsink temperature
increases, the peak current capability of the drive is reduced to ensure the IGBT die temperature cannot increase above
the device maximum rating.
For the DS2100 D size, a simple thermal shutdown is implemented. These drives will report an overtemperature fault
once the measured heatsink temperature exceeds the maximum rating of the drive.
